Motors

This is how the new stepper motors were mounted, to replace the servo motors. Two 16 tooth pulleys for a 1:1 ratio, since the Vexta NEMA11 motors have an 18:1 gear head which is sufficient gear reduction. One screw goes into the hole in a corner, and anther new hole was drilled and made a bit wider than the screw. This allowed the belt to be put then tensioned by pulling the motor away from the other pulley, then tightening the screw, which has a washer.
